These are the Main Service messages for TCC. We exist to worship God, to exalt His Son, our Lord Jesus Christ, to nurture and care for one another, and to share the good news about the forgiveness of sins found in Christ alone. Because we believe the Bible is God’s inspired and inerrant Word to us, Scripture is our ultimate authority. It is relevant and authoritative for every generation and sufficient for the issues one faces in this life. We trust that in the worship services and throughout every ministry, you will discover that our central message is the same–the Word of God.
